Pushm - Renesas R8C/Tiny Series Software Manual

16-bit single-chip microcomputer
Hide thumbs Also See for R8C/Tiny Series:
Table of Contents

Advertisement

Chapter 3 Functions

PUSHM

[ Syntax ]
PUSHM
src
[ Operation ]
SP
SP
M(SP)
src
*1 Number of registers saved.
[ Function ]
• This instruction saves the registers selected by
• The registers are saved to the stack area in the following order:
[ Selectable src ]
R0 R1 R2 R3 A0 A1 SB FB
src
*2 More than one
[ Flag Change ]
Flag
U
I
O
Change
[ Description Example ]
PUSHM
R0,R1,A0,SB,FB
[ Related Instructions ]
Rev.2.00 Oct 17, 2005
REJ09B0001-0200
Save multiple registers
N
*1
2
R0 R1 R2 R3 A0 A1 SB FB
Saved sequentially beginning with FB
*2
src
can be chosen.
B
S
Z
D
C
POP, PUSH, POPM
page 107 of 263
PUSH Multiple
[ Instruction Code/Number of Cycles ]
src
collectively to the stack area.
3.2
Functions
PUSHM
Page: 217

Advertisement

Table of Contents
loading

Table of Contents